I'm going for a repeat result of Saturday August 17th 1991.

The insanity and poetry of it being the opening fixture never quite sunk in and despite us all being a little bit on the stocious side, courtesy of The Fradley Arms, we elbowed through cries of "JOOOOduss" over and over again.

Then it was mind-blowing....the concept of BFR had not yet been developed so it was "Atkinson's Claret & Blue Army" for what seemed like an hour up to kick-off, at deafening levels and in perfect harmony. The Wednesday fans seemed gobsmacked into silence.

What a cracking day that was....here's to a repeat.

One of my favourite ever away-days. Seemingly endless choruses of 'Thank you very much for Big Fat Ron, thank you very much, thank you very much ...' The locals were unimpressed - which only added to the fun.

We were battered in the first half when David Hirst was outstanding but then goals from big Cyrille, Dalian Atkinson and a late winner from Stan Staunton gave us the win. Brilliant day.
